Output 7650615ece05d2f88dc4cff2f8ddb7704f1b178728cd548ffed84a1cce026e2f:114

value
19000
script pubkey
OP_0 OP_PUSHBYTES_20 e8f87187d25b04fc1367570704ae389bbcafde28
address
bc1qaru8rp7jtvz0cym82ursft3cnw72lh3gc5u2wg
transaction
7650615ece05d2f88dc4cff2f8ddb7704f1b178728cd548ffed84a1cce026e2f
confirmations
52306
spent
true